Another good one for Sam!

It is quite surprising to see Sam release yet another single, her sixth since "Gotta Tell You". However, this song is beautiful, and although it won't be her best chart-topping single, it is still a great release for her, probably her last before her follow-up album is announced.

I bought this single mostly because of the video, since they won't play it in Quebec... The video is quite nice, although it is very simple and repetitive. The colours are flashy and Samantha looks like Janet Jackson with her long hair. I prefer energetic videos like "Gotta Tell You" and "Baby Come On Over", which enhance Samantha's young energy.

The remixes are also worth the buy, with Track #2 being pretty clubbish, but very interesting.

Needless to say that "Lately" being a slow, gospel song, it was a risk trying to turn it into a club mix, but they did it amazingly well. Track #3 is a particular techno remix with a beat that actually makes the song sound like a 80's hit.

Another great release for Samantha Mumba, well worth a listen, and a buy!
